How How to Update Skype on a Mac Actually Works
Updating Skype on Mac is a straightforward process that preserves your existing setup while bringing you the latest features. Start by downloading the newest version from the Mac App Store or Skype’s official website, ensuring the installer is genuine. Once opened, follow the on-screen prompts to install updates—this typically includes system compatibility checks and permission confirmations.
